我的问题涉及从Twitter上分享的链接到iOS 9上的应用程序的深层链接。
在iOS 9之前,在重定向中使用应用程序的URL方案会将用户从Twitter带入该应用程序。现在,正如所描述的here(我假设这是它不再有效的原因),Twitter无法打开其他应用程序的URL方案。它仍适用于iOS 9的Facebook应用程序,我认为不同之处在于Twitter使用canOpenUrl:
,现在返回NO
。
这让我尝试了Universal Links,但在我目前的实施中,这些仅在Safari中运行。
有没有人找到解决方案或解决方法?
答案 0 :(得分:0)
将Twitter方案添加到您的Info.plist。
<key>LSApplicationQueriesSchemes</key>
<array>
<string>twitter</string>
</array>